My PS4 is performing like new since I upgraded the hard drive, I didn’t realise how slow and unresponsive it had become, definitely worth it. It loads faster, things install faster, the ui reacts quicker rather than lagging a second or two behind, it doesn’t freeze, it hasn’t had a single error yet (early days granted). Perfect! What I would say is it's a very slow paced game and the mood is quite bleak (I can't believe it's from the same studio as GTA5 tbh) there will be fun hijinks and heists and such but they're like a vodka shot on the side rather than the main drink.

There's a lot of conversation, side activities, tragedy and reflecting to yourself on the tit that just happened in the previous mission while you're travelling across the map to somewhere else. The character writing is pretty good and I've gotten attached to the main character and most of the rest of the gang, but it's also very good at making you hate certain people (or like them as a person while still knowing they're absolutely no good for the main character and not trusting them at all).

Oh and there is a lot of hunting/animals dying in the game so be aware of that if it would be too upsetting - hunting is a side activity and I think a few main missions involve it. The horses are great though, I don't even like horses that much in real life but I would die for my horse in RDR2 (he's a black Arabian horse I think), sometimes I just pat/brush and feed them for like a few minutes at a time 😂
